Output 3fe88654f1c3d006a3c3f9eeb7ab0acb7d5070bf0b0950d15baf12b281d4038e:32

value
34411260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d85bff37e18199d4676c3c401c0aad2be5cca72 OP_EQUAL
address
MC3rsAMwtiExhouyXFKzfJuQAZNqQJhdrt
transaction
3fe88654f1c3d006a3c3f9eeb7ab0acb7d5070bf0b0950d15baf12b281d4038e
spent
true